Plenum Feed with Room Return
The
CONTEG Plenum Feed with Room Return solution optimises the use of
cooled air by directing the cooled air directly from the raised floor
to the equipment within the rack. The rack sits onto a special
positioning welded frame which replaces a standard 600 x 600 floor
tile. A deflector located
in the bottom of the rack directs the cold air to the front of the rack
to be drawn through the equipment mounted inside.

Cooled
air is kept within the rack by a solid front door which can be either
glass or metal depending on preference and hot exhaust air is rejected
into the room through a super-vented rear door ensuring that cold
supply and hot exhaust air-streams remain separated leading to more
efficient use of the cooled air and elimination of hot spots.
A
variable flowrate Louvre can be installed to control air-flow rates or
shut air supply off if no equipment is fitted into the rack. One
significant advantage of the Plenum Feed Room Return system is the
flexibility of floor planning. Dedicated hot and cold aisles are no
longer required as the rack contains and separates the hot and cold
airstreams. Direct rack cold air feed requires the use of air-separation frames for maximum efficiency.

Separation frame
is used for minimizing by-pass airflow between columns and extrusions.
Thanks to this function is separation frame basic feature when cool
zone inside the rack is planned. The rack is easily and stably mounted to a raised floor by using the positioning welded plinth.
Positioning plinth has welded structure and thanks to its size 600 x
600 mm replaces a standard floor tile. Using positioning welded plinth
sit not only the rack onto the raised floor but also helps to lead the
cold air directly to the rack.
Deflector is
located in the bottom part of the rack and is used to lead the cold air
directly to the cold zone in front part of a rack. Deflector can be
equipped with louvre which helps to control air-flow rates or shut air
supply off if no equipment is fitted into the rack.

Recommended Plenum feed with room return rack design
Cold air enters the rack directly through the plinth and is directed using an air deflector to the area in front of the uprights. An air separation frame and solid front door (glass or steel) is then used to create a "cold zone" in front of the equipment inside the rack. A super-vented rear door allows warm exhaust air to easily exit the rack.
- Front glass door with multipoint swivel handle lock
- Rear vented door (83% perforation rate) with multipoint swivel handle lock
- Removable sheet steel side panels with lock
- Two pairs of 19" vertical sliding extrusions
- Top and bottom openings for cable entry; removable top plate (only RDF racks)
- Adjustable feet; combined with positioning welded frame DP-PRF-ROF-60/60

Computational
Fluid Dynamics (CFD) modeling is a technical service designed to
provide the detailed data to assess and track the temperature and air
flow within your existing or proposed data center, server room or main
equipment room.Working with your design team the Conteg team of
specialists will assist in the space planning and layout, then model
your project. The CFD model will simulate the air flows, air pressures
